Essential Job Duties:
The Kleiner Lab at North Carolina State University (www.kleinerlab.org) is seeking a Research Specialist to support ongoing research on complex microbial communities, microbial symbioses, and metaproteomics. The successful candidate will contribute to experimental design, execution, and data analysis within a dynamic and collaborative research environment.
Responsibilities include managing multiple concurrent research projects; cultivating and maintaining root-associated bacterial cultures; performing molecular and biochemical assays; and compiling and analyzing experimental data. The position requires proficiency in molecular and cell biology techniques applied to bacterial systems. Research outcomes will support publications, conference presentations, and grant development. In addition to research duties, the Research Specialist will assist with laboratory management, including maintaining safety documentation and compliance, coordinating undergraduate research assistant schedules, and overseeing equipment purchasing, maintenance, and repair.
At present, this position is time-limited for three (3) years, with possible renewal based on funding.

Minimum Experience/Education:
Bachelor's degree in a discipline related to the area of assignment; or an equivalent combination of training and experience.
All degrees must be received from appropriately accredited institutions.
Required Qualifications:
- Microbiology and Molecular Biology Expertise: Demonstrated experience in microbiology, molecular biology, and biochemistry techniques, including PCR, gel electrophoresis, and related laboratory methods.
- Microbial Cultivation and Preservation: Proficiency in cultivating, maintaining, and preserving bacterial cultures; anaerobic cultivation experience is a plus.
- Microscopy Skills: Ability to perform microscopy for cell counting and phenotypic characterization.
- Data and Software Proficiency: Experience using Microsoft Office applications and scientific data analysis tools; familiarity with R Studio is advantageous.
- Field Research Capability: Ability to participate in field work at agricultural or marine sites, including sampling, sample processing, and supporting field logistics; willingness to travel up to two weeks per year.
